Michael Kellner is a German politician associated with the Green Party, known for his focus on energy policy. He previously served as the State Secretary in the Federal Ministry for Economic Affairs and Climate Action, where he dealt with issues relating to energy security and sustainability. Kellner has been vocal about concerns surrounding the Nord Stream 2 pipeline, viewing it as a symbol of Germany's dependency on Russian energy and advocating for a transparent and sustainable energy future.
